Disable - Log in Request - Personal Desktop MS Power BI

I have been using BI for over a month now without issue. Recently, an annoying pop up has occurred - requesting I sign in to my user account. I am not a student and this is my personal account - not business email. I have tried numerous "tips" on how to disable this request. I am basically frozen from working on my projects because this email request keeps popping up. Please is there anyone out there that can help. Details: Windows 11, PC, paid Microsoft Online Subscription. Version: MS Power BI Desktop version.

If you are experiencing persistent login prompts in Microsoft Power BI Desktop while using a personal account on Windows 11 with a paid Microsoft Online subscription, this is often due to cached credentials or conflicts with the Windows Authentication Manager (WAM).

To address this, please clear any stored credentials by going to File > Options and Settings > Data Source Settings > Clear Permissions, as previously suggested by @Akash_Varuna 


You may also consider disabling WAM authentication by adding a DWORD entry named UseWAM with a value of 0 in the Windows Registry under H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Power BI Desktop. This will switch Power BI Desktop to legacy authentication and can help resolve repeated login issues. Additionally, in Power BI Desktop, navigate to File > Options > Global > Security and uncheck Require user authentication for single sign-on to prevent unnecessary sign-in prompts. If the problem continues, performing a clean reinstallation of Power BI Desktop may help reset configuration and authentication settings.

To stop the Power BI sign-in prompt:

  1. Run as Administrator – Right-click Power BI > Run as administrator.

  2. Registry Fix
    Go to H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Power BI Desktop,
    create DWORD EnableSignIn = 0.

  3. Disable Auto Sign-In – In Power BI: File > Options > Security, turn off sign-in options.

This should stop the prompt.

Hi @CTomk It might be due to cached credentials or authentication settings. Clear cached credentials via File > Options and Settings > Data Source Settings. To stop prompts, uncheck "Require user authentication for single sign-on" under File > Options > Global > Security. If the issue persists, reinstall Power BI Desktop or contact Microsoft support for further assistance.
